Protect Yourself Against Fraud

We prioritize the security of our members. Members who believe their information has been compromised should take the following precautionary steps to safeguard their information.

Compromised Account

If you believe your debit or credit card information has been compromised, text ‘Compromised Account’ to 906-341-5866 to request a new card.

Social Security Number

If your Social Security Number is at risk, review and monitor your credit report through SavvyMoney within the LFCU Mobile App, and consider placing a credit freeze on your report for added protection.

Monitor Account

If your account number may have been exposed, use Online Banking and the LFCU Mobile App to regularly monitor your transactions.

  • Consider closing your account and opening a new one to change your account number.
  • Create a secure password to your Online Banking/Mobile App Account and remember to change it often.
  • Set-up additional login methods for ease of account access in the LFCU Mobile App (PIN, Face ID, or Voice ID).
